Imagine a radiant cut diamond perched atop a split shank ring, both elegant and timeless. This style is captivating, with the stone's unique facets catching light from every angle, creating a mesmerizing dance of sparkle. The split shank itself is a bit of an unsung hero. It splits the band into two (or more) strands, offering a visual intrigue that draws the eye without overpowering the central gem.

The split shank design itself has roots in various jewelry traditions. It offers more surface area to embed smaller diamonds or other gemstones and can lend an air of sophistication to any setting. What's particularly fascinating is how this design can slink between modern and vintage aesthetics depending on the metal used. Yellow gold gives it an antique feel, while platinum or white gold makes it contemporary-chic. The versatility is part of its charm.

In terms of durability, both radiant cut diamonds and split shank designs stand the test of time. Radiant cuts hide inclusions and blemishes well, making them a pragmatic choice for someone who wears their jewelry daily. The split shank, with its supportive structure, secures the stone while adding an additional layer of durability.
